    From 15 September 2021 to 19 September 2021

    Raced as #74, named Cassie.
    Competed at the National Championship Air Races in the Formula One class. The primary pilot was Shaun Milke from Fairbanks, AK. Qualified in 13th place with an average speed of 176.767 mph. Raced in Heat 1B. Finished in 4th place with an average speed of 169.37 mph. Raced in Heat 2C. Finished in 2nd place with an average speed of 180.608 mph. Did not start in the Championship race.

    From 14 September 2022 to 18 September 2022

    Raced as #74, named Phat Ass Cass.
    Competed at the National Championship Air Races in the Formula One class. The primary pilot was Shaun Milke from Fairbanks, AK. Qualified in 12th place with an average speed of 181.152 mph. Raced in Heat 1B. Finished in 3rd place with an average speed of 184.533 mph. Raced in Heat 2C. Finished in 3rd place with an average speed of 186.79 mph. Raced in Heat 3D. Finished in 3rd place with an average speed of 184.115 mph. Raced in the Consolation race. Finished in 3rd place with an average speed of 191.008 mph.

    From 13 September 2023 to 17 September 2023

    Raced as #74, named PHAT ASS CASS.
    Competed at the National Championship Air Races in the Formula One class. The primary pilot was Shaun Milke from Fairbanks, AK. Qualified in 17th place with an average speed of 185.552 mph. Raced in Heat 1C. Finished in 1st place with an average speed of 187.686 mph. Raced in Heat 2C. Finished in 5th place with an average speed of 178.384 mph. Raced in Heat 3D. Finished in 5th place with an average speed of 180.556 mph. Raced in the Consolation race. Finished in 6th place with an average speed of 180.889 mph.
